The is a specific integrated circuit (IC) code identifying a high-capacity 128GB eMMC (embedded MultiMediaCard) memory chip manufactured by Micron . In the specialized world of mobile device repair and embedded systems engineering, "JZ150" serves as a crucial shorthand for technicians to identify compatible replacement parts for smartphones, tablets, and IoT gateways.
